Overshoot

Definition of Overshoot

O`ver`shoot´
v. t.1.To shoot over or beyond; to miss; as, to overshoot a mark; to overshoot the green in golf.
[imp. & p. p. Overshot ; p. pr. & vb. n. Overshooting.]
2.To go beyond an intended point or limit; as, to overshoot the runway in landing an airplane; to overshoot the endpoint in a titration.
2.To pass swiftly over; to fly beyond.
3.To exceed; as, to overshoot the truth.
To overshoot one's self
to venture too far; to assert too much.
v. i.1.To fly beyond the mark.
